Smartgit License File [portable] Jun 2026

(often run via Docker) to manage and distribute licenses automatically to employees. Hidden Files : On Linux/macOS, directories starting with a dot (like ) are hidden. Press in your file manager to reveal them. Are you looking to switch to a non-commercial license , or are you setting up a company-wide distribution Company-wide installation - SmartGit - Docs - syntevo

Working at a non-profit organization or government entity (in most cases, unless explicitly exempted by syntevo).

If you are using a subscription license and it expires, SmartGit will stop working, necessitating a renewal to continue using the software. Offline Usage

| Issue | Possible Cause(s) | Solution(s) | | :--- | :--- | :--- | | | License expired; subscription renewal failed; missing internet access. | 1. Check your subscription status and ensure payment is up to date. 2. Ensure SmartGit has internet access to fetch updated license files. 3. Manually download the latest license file from your email and re-register it. 4. If on a subscription, an old expired license will not work. You must use the latest file. | | SmartGit cannot download updated license automatically | Network restrictions (firewall/proxy); SmartGit proxy settings misconfigured. | 1. Ensure SmartGit can access the internet. 2. If behind a corporate proxy, configure the proxy settings in Preferences > Advanced > Proxy to allow automatic license fetching. | | Cannot change license option after trial period | Previous license state "locked" due to leftover configuration files. | 1. Delete the license file and preferences.yml (or settings.xml for older versions) from the settings directory as described in Section 6. 2. Reinstall SmartGit without deleting these files may not solve the problem. | | "Invalid License File" error | Corrupted .lic file; mismatched license type. | 1. Double-check that you are using the correct license type for your usage (e.g., non-commercial license for commercial work will not work). 2. Re-download the .lic file from your email or Syntevo account and try registering again. | | SSH key not recognized | SmartGit may not support OPENSSH format keys by default. | When generating SSH keys, use the -m PEM flag to generate a PEM-compatible key: ssh-keygen -m PEM -t rsa -b 4096 -C "your_email@example.com" . | | Multiple licenses exist on same machine | Previous license file not fully removed; outdated license leftover. | 1. Go to the SmartGit settings directory and ensure there is only one file named license . 2. Delete any extra or outdated .lic files in that directory. | smartgit license file

Free for open-source developers, students, and employees of public academic or charitable institutions. You can apply for one through the SmartGit Non-Commercial License form . Managing Your License File

In enterprise environments, system administrators may need to deploy license files silently across multiple workstations without user intervention. You can achieve this by placing the license file directly into SmartGit's settings directory.

Upon successful payment, syntevo will email you a registration link or attach the license file directly. 2. Requesting a Non-Commercial License Open SmartGit. (often run via Docker) to manage and distribute

| | Key Takeaway | | :--- | :--- | | License Nature | The .lic file is a binary, per-user license. Do not edit it. | | Installation | Use Help -> Register inside SmartGit to load the file. | | File Location | Stored as a file called license in your OS-specific settings directory. | | License Types | Choose between Perpetual (one-time, indefinite use) or Subscription (recurring, auto-updates). | | Non-Commercial Use | Free for OSS devs, academics, and charities . Apply online. | | Admin Deployment | For 10+ users , place a license file in the default directory of the installation. | | Troubleshooting | Delete license and preferences.yml (v21.2+) or settings.xml (older). |

Navigate to your local downloads folder, select your .lic license file, and click .

To get your license file, follow the appropriate pathway based on your use case: 1. Purchasing a Commercial License Visit the official website. Navigate to the SmartGit Purchase page. Select your desired subscription or perpetual license tier. Complete the checkout process. Are you looking to switch to a non-commercial

You have copied the entire text string (including headers and footers) if pasting the key manually. 2. "License Expired" Notification

(requiring 23.1 preview) where the user is the only author/committer, or the repository is open source.

From this experience, John learned some valuable best practices:

Your SmartGit license file is a proof of purchase. While it generally does not contain sensitive personal data, you should treat it as a serial number.